Pump.fun Fires Workers Before They Could Claim Millions in PUMP Tokens

Pump.fun, the Solana-based memecoin launchpad, reportedly fired employees two months before they were due to receive millions in PUMP tokens, according to a Sandmark report. Co-founder Noah Tweedale attributed the layoffs to the company growing 'too quickly,' leaving employees without the tokens promised in agreements signed for 2025. The situation raises questions about corporate governance and transparency in the crypto ecosystem, particularly in memecoin projects that have seen exponential growth. The laid-off employees, who were set to receive a quarter of their allocated tokens in June 2026, now face significant financial uncertainties as the cryptocurrency market remains volatile.
